Payment figures come from the federal Open Payments program, which requires drug and device companies to report what they pay physicians for consulting, speaking, meals, travel and royalties. A disclosed payment is a financial relationship, not evidence of wrongdoing, and many totals reflect a single meal. Figures cover calendar year 2025.

Where does this data come from?

Provider records come from the federal NPPES registry and CMS Doctors and Clinicians files. Payment figures come from the CMS Open Payments program for calendar year 2025. The directory refreshes monthly.
